Another Math whiz kid of Regional Science High School (RSHS) will advance to the next qualifying stage of the 14th Philippine Mathematical Olympiad (PMO) on November 26 after making it to the top 50 slot in the Luzon Area qualifying round.
Mitzi Love C. Syjongtian, the Math whiz kid, followed the fate of Kevin Wai Yin S. Lam who hurdled the same exam in 2010 but failed to make in the top 20 examinees nationwide.
Determined to end the medal drought in PMO, Romel L. Ricardo, Math Department Head, is hopeful that this year, a Regscihyer will make it to the top 20 examinees in the second qualifying stage considering the caliber of Syjongtian.
Asked how they prepared to secure a spot in the PMO, Ricardo told he conducted series of reviews and gave Syjongtian Math reviewers to refresh herself on topics in Algebra, Geometry, Trigonometry and Calculus.
“Qualifying in the PMO is like passing through the proverbial eye of a needle. So there’s no need for us to be idle nor to lax,” said Ricardo.
The PMO is run by the Mathematical Society of the Philippines through the Department of Science and Technology – Science Education Institute (DOST-SEI) and Department of Education (DepEd) with support of private and business sectors.
